FAQ

  • What version of Painter can I use for this course?

    This course is presented to you with Painter 2022 and 2023. Students may also use Painter 2021 for this course. Consider this course as applicable to Painter 2021 or greater.

  • What do I need for this course?

    You will need Corel Painter 2021 or greater for this course. The experience will be enhanced if you use a Wacom, Xencelabs tablet and stylus or a compatible tablet. You can also download the 30 day trial version of Painter for this course.
